Towards Efficient Call Admission Control Criterion for State-Dependent Routing in Multirate Networks

Summary, in English

We consider a link serving multiple service classes. We evaluate the properties of the link admission control policies that are obtained from an efficient scheme proposed by Krishnan and Hubner (1997). The Krishnan and Hubner approach suggests efficient calculations of state-dependent routing criteria for multi-rate networks through state-space aggregation. Through simple examples we show that it is possible that the approximations made in the approach might lead to degraded performance, instead of the expected improvement. We outline and discuss a possible extension to the Krishnan and Hubner approach in an effort to address this problem
